Throughout April and May 2009, six road shows were held across Scotland with the aim of raising awareness of:
- The contribution planning can make to sustainable economic growth,
- The legal framework within which planning will operate, and
- The central contributions that culture change can make.
The Scottish Government, Heads of Planning Scotland, key Agencies and representatives of the private sector presented to local authority chief executives and elected members as well as front line planning and agency staff.
The note of the events includes:
- An outline of the programme and attendance;
- Summaries of talks by the Chief Planner, Assistant Chief Planner, Heads of Planning Scotland, Agencies and the Private Sector.
